Luke works in the firm’s employment and business litigation practice groups. Luke has represented clients in arbitrations regarding breaches of contract and fraud allegations, Title VII discrimination cases before the EEOC and federal court, whistleblower retaliation matters, overtime cases brought under the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A), and severance negations, among other matters. Luke previously clerked for a Georgia Superior Court Judge sitting in the Mountain Judicial Circuit. As a clerk, Luke gained familiarity with a diverse range of issues arising in civil litigation, allowing him to deliver effective results for his clients.

Luke graduated from Emory University School of Law in 2022. While at Emory, he served as a Notes and Comments Editor for the Emory International Law Review and Secretary for the Federalist Society. His Comment, Parents Versus Parens Patriae: The Troubling Legality of Germany’s Homeschool Ban and Textual Basis for Its Removal (36 EMORY INT’L L. REV. 201 (2022)) was published in the Emory International Law Review’s Volume 36, Issue 1. Prior to law school, Luke graduated from Vanderbilt University with highest honors in History. Luke is a member of the State Bar of Georgia and is admitted to practice before all Georgia trial courts, the Court of Appeals of Georgia, and the Supreme Court of Georgia. Luke has also been admitted to the U.S. Federal District Court for the Northern and Middle Districts of Georgia.

Outside of work, Luke is active in the community as a member of Westminster Presbyterian Church. He enjoys weightlifting, model railroading, fly fishing and traveling with his wife, a professor at Emory University, and his daughter.
